WebHow many watts for blender to crush ice? A blender that needs to crush ice should have at least 600 watts of power or more. This watt is powerful enough to crush ice conveniently and effectively within a short time with great results. Below 600 watts, these blenders may not be powerful enough to crush ice, it will take longer and the results ...
